Promising young goalkeeper Oscar Kelly signs his first pro contract with Liverpool

According to the club’s official site (h/t Liverpool Echo), promising young shot-stopper Oscar Kelly has signed his first professional contract with Liverpool.

The youngster has been on the club’s rolls since the Under-9 level. He rose through the ranks over the years and has now gotten the reward for his efforts. Signing your first professional deal is a big moment for youth players and Kelly now has the opportunity to show he deserves it.

The 18-year-old was a key player for Liverpool’s Under-18 and Under-23 sides. He also featured for the Under-19s in the UEFA Youth League in 2018/19.

Kelly appears to be a dependable asset to the club. If the club statement is anything to go by, there appears to be great faith placed in his shot-stopping abilities.

Reds’ boss Jurgen Klopp isn’t shy of handing his promising young players an opportunity or two to impress themselves. Trent Alexander-Arnold is today one of the best young players in the world and Harvey Elliott also appears to be on the same trajectory.

The owners FSG, have also made their intentions of grooming young talent very evident. Their investment of £50m in building a new state of the art training complex for the Merseyside team in Kirkby is clear evidence of that.

The Reds have made the pathway for the younger players much more easy as they look to get more players from the academy into the first-team setup. Whether Kelly will soon join the ranks of Liverpool’s first-team remains to be seen.
